What to Expect: 

  1. PlayLab Demo: PlayLab AI is a nonprofit platform that empowers educators, students, and organizations to create, customize, and share their own AI-powered educational tools. It provides an accessible, no-code environment designed to support the creation of applications tailored to unique teaching and learning needs. 
  2. Opening Keynote: A live interview with Helen Norris, Vice President and Chief Information Officer, to learn about her life and work experiences. 
  3. Zoom AI Companion:Discover the power of Zoom AI Companion in a workshop designed to seamlessly integrate AI into your virtual meetings for enhanced productivity and efficiency. 
  4. PantherAI: PantherAI brings together the power of GPT-4 (via Azure OpenAI), Claude (Anthropic), and Gemini (Google) into one unified platform. Instead of limiting yourself to the capabilities of a single model, PantherAI offers a multi-model approach, giving you flexibility, efficiency, and broader capabilities in one place. 
  5. Deepfakes: Discover how AI-generated media is reshaping the digital landscape—learn how to spot deepfakes, understand their implications, and protect yourself and the organization from potential misuse. 
  6. Lightning Talks: Join our lightning talks to pick up project management tips with Microsoft Loop, learn how to use AI to streamline your workflow, and get a quick look at the powerful features of NotebookLM—all in fast, focused sessions.
